Understanding Network Topology
Network topology describes the layout of a network’s components. These include computers, routers, and switches. It’s a key concept in network design. Data transmission quality depends on network performance. This article explores network topologies, their traits, and real-world uses.
Types of Network Topologies
Two main types categorize network topologies: physical and logical.
Physical Topology
Imagine a blueprint of your network. That’s essentially what a physical topology represents. It illustrates the physical arrangement of network devices and links. This includes where to place computers, routers, switches, and their cables.
Logical Topology
The physical topology shows the hardware and connections. The logical topology reveals how data flows in the network.
It shows, at a high level, the paths data packets take. It also shows the rules for data transmission and device communication, regardless of location.
Devices connect to a central hub in a physically wired star network.
However, the logical topology might be a ring. Data travels in a circle through each device. They are physically connected to a central hub.
Common Network Topologies
Let’s dive into some of the most commonly used network topologies:
1. Bus Topology
In a bus topology, all devices connect to a single central cable, called the bus. This creates a simple, linear structure where data travels in both directions along the cable. Bus topologies are cheap and easy to set up. However, they can bottleneck with heavy traffic.
All devices share the same communication channel. So, collisions can occur, slowing the network.
For example, early Ethernet networks used a bus topology.
2. Star Topology
The star topology is incredibly common, perhaps the most prevalent in homes and offices. In this setup, all devices connect to a central hub, resembling a star and its points. This hub acts as a central connection point, receiving data from one device and relaying it to the others. Star topologies perform better than bus topologies. They reduce data collisions. Network resilience shines through distributed design. A single device’s failure leaves the system intact, safeguarding overall functionality.
The central node poses a critical vulnerability. If it malfunctions, the entire network goes down. Real-world example: Home and office networks often use star topology. Streamlined, user-friendly, and built for growth.
3. Ring Topology
Picture a circle of devices, each connected to its two neighbors – that’s a ring topology. Data travels in one direction around the ring, passing through each device until it reaches its destination. Ring topologies offer a relatively even distribution of network resources and can span larger distances compared to bus topologies. However, a single device failure can disrupt the entire network. Also, adding or removing a device requires a temporary network shutdown.
Real-world example: Some fiber optic networks and industrial control systems use ring topologies for their resilience in challenging environments.
4. Mesh Topology
Mesh topologies are all about redundancy. In this interconnected structure, each device connects to multiple other devices, creating multiple data paths. If one path fails, data can be rerouted. This makes mesh networks highly resilient. Resilient to failure, these systems excel in vital roles where continuous operation is paramount.
However, mesh networks are harder and costlier to install and manage. They need more cabling and hardware.
Real-world example: Wireless mesh networks are popular for their flexibility and coverage. They are often used in city-wide Wi-Fi and large industrial areas.
5. Tree Topology
The tree topology combines bus and star topologies. It arranges devices in a hierarchical, tree-like structure. Multiple star networks, each with its central hub, connect to a linear bus backbone. This design allows for network expansion and segmentation. It’s more scalable than bus or ring topologies and offers easier management than complex mesh networks. However, the central backbone represents a single point of failure.
Real-world example: Large enterprise networks often use tree topology to connect multiple departments or branches while maintaining central control.
6. Hybrid Topology
Networks blend like a cocktail in hybrid topologies. Administrators mix and match, leveraging strengths while minimizing flaws. This adaptable approach lets them craft custom designs, precisely meeting unique needs. Flexibility reigns as multiple structures merge, creating tailored solutions for diverse requirements. For instance, a company might use a star topology for its office network and connect multiple offices using a bus topology.
Real-world example: Large university campuses or corporate networks often utilize hybrid topologies to accommodate diverse network needs across various departments and locations.
Why Network Topology Matters
The choice of network topology significantly impacts several critical factors:
- Performance: The topology dictates how efficiently data moves across the network. A bus topology might struggle with heavy traffic, while star or mesh topologies can handle larger data loads with minimal performance degradation.
- Scalability: As networks grow, the chosen topology should accommodate new devices and increased data traffic without significant performance hits. Star and tree topologies generally offer better scalability compared to bus or ring topologies.
- Fault Tolerance: Network downtime can be costly. Topologies like mesh and ring, with their redundant data paths, provide higher fault tolerance, ensuring network availability even if one connection or device fails.
Network diagrams, visual representations of the chosen topology, are essential tools for network administrators. They simplify network management, aid in troubleshooting, and facilitate communication among technical teams.
Understanding Key Concepts
Here are two important networking concepts closely tied to topology:
- Data’s journey from source to destination defines latency. This delay, measured between request and response, impacts user experience. Fast networks minimize lag, while slow connections frustrate users. Optimizing for low latency enhances digital interactions, making applications feel snappier and more responsive. The right topology and network equipment can significantly impact latency.
- Redundancy: Redundancy means having backup systems or components to ensure continuous operation in case of failure. This can include redundant network paths, devices, or even entire data centers. Mesh topologies have multiple data paths, making them duplicate resources.
The Future: Software-Defined Networking (SDN)
This article focused on traditional, hardware-based topologies. But the networking landscape is evolving. SDN revolutionizes network management by decoupling control from data operations. This modern approach splits decision-making from packet forwarding, enabling more flexible and efficient network architectures. Software-Defined Networking empowers administrators with centralized control and programmability, transforming how networks function and adapt. This separation allows for more flexible and dynamic network configurations. SDN lets network admins manage and optimize traffic via software. They redesign layouts and integrate new services with increased productivity. It reduces reliance on physical topologies. This allows for more agile, responsive networks.
Conclusion
Network topology is key to network design. It affects performance, reliability, scalability, and cost. Each topology has its strengths and weaknesses. So, it’s crucial to choose one that fits the network’s needs and limits. As networks grow more complex and data demands rise, we must understand network topologies. It is key to building robust, efficient, and future-proof networks.